我有一个带有10个对象的arraylist“ Numlist”
在每个对象中都有一个String [10]数组“ Num”。
如何访问和显示特定的字符串(例如Num [8])?
所以它是一个.html文件,带有html和javascripts。 我有一个带有10个对象的arraylist“ Numlist”, 每个对象都包含一个字符串“ name”和一个字符串[10]“ Num”
我可以使用{{name}}
轻松访问并显示“名称”,
但是我不能使用{{Num.0}}在网上找到的方法,
访问并在“ Num [0]”中显示字符串,
{{#Numlist}}
<div class="data-table">
<table>
<tbody>
<tr>
<td >{{name}}</td>
<td >{{Num.0}}</td>
</tr>
</tbody>
</table>
</div>
{{/Numlist}}
我希望输出应该是类似
的表
[name] [Num [0]中的字符串]
但是我只有
[名称] []
看来{{Num.0}}根本不起作用。
还有另一种方法来访问array中的特定元素, 还是我以错误的方式使用{{num.0}}这种方法?
答案 0 :(得分:0)
使用括号表示法访问数组元素-如果使用点表示法,则会引发错误:
const arr = [1, 2, 3];
console.log(arr..2);
使用[0]
:
{{Num[0]}}